Detail from the "Colonna del Verziere" ("Column of the Greengrocery market") in Milan, Italy. The column was erected in 1580 as an ex voto for the end of the 1577 plague epidemy. It was completed only in 1673, when the statue of Jesus, sculpted by Giuseppe and Gian Battista Vismara on a drawing by Francesco Maria Richini, was added. It is also a monument bearing since 1860 the names of the patriots of Milan who fell during the "Five days of Milan"insurgency (1849). Picture by Giovanni Dall'Orto, January 11 2009.

Collect of the Day | Easter 6
O God, you have prepared for those who love you such
good things as surpass our understanding: Pour into our
hearts such love towards you, that we, loving you in all
things and above all things, may obtain your promises,
which exceed all that we can desire; through Jesus Christ
our Lord, who lives and reigns with you and the Holy Spirit,
one God, for ever and ever. Amen.

For All Sorts and Conditions
O God, the creator and preserver of all, we humbly beseech you for all sorts
and conditions of people; that you would be pleased to make your ways known
unto them, your saving health unto all nations. More especially we pray for
your holy Church universal; that it may be so guided and governed by your
good Spirit, that all who profess and call themselves Christians may be led
into the way of truth, and hold the faith in unity of spirit, in the bond of peace,
and in righteousness of life. Finally, we commend to your fatherly goodness all those
who are in any ways afflicted or distressed, in mind, body, or estate;
that it may please you to comfort and relieve them according to their
several necessities, giving them patience under their sufferings, and a happy
issue out of all their afflictions. And this we beg for Jesus Christ's sake. Amen.
